4 Technical requirements
4.1 The tractor shall comply with the requirements of this standard and be manufactured according to the product drawings and technical documents approved through the prescribed procedures. 4.2 The parts, components, accessories and attachments of the tractor shall comply with the provisions of relevant standards. 4.3 The connections of various parts on the tractor shall be firm. 4.4 The tractor shall not leak oil, water or air, and mud and water shall not be allowed to penetrate into the body. 4.5 The painting of the tractor shall comply with the provisions of NJ226, and the surface shall be smooth and flat, with uniform color and no obvious paint defects. 4.6 The exposed surface of the casting shall be smooth and clean, without cracks and serious defects such as sand adhesion, fleshy pores, etc. The surface of the forging shall be smooth and clean, without defects such as cracks, flash and burrs.
4.7 Stamping parts shall be flat, without defects such as cracks and wrinkles that affect the appearance. 4.8 The welds of welded parts shall be uniform and firm, without defects such as leakage and burn-through, slag inclusion, undercut, pores, etc. 4.9 The metal coating and oxidation treatment layer shall not peel off or rust. 4.10 Each operating mechanism should be light and flexible, with appropriate tightness. All spring-returned operating handles should automatically return to their original positions after the operating force is removed.
The regulator operating mechanism should ensure that the engine can operate stably within the full speed range and can stop the engine. 4.12 On the test track, the tractor traction specific fuel consumption under the maximum traction power condition of the main tillage gear should not exceed 485g/kWh. 4.13 After the tractor is run-in as required, the rated power, fuel consumption rate and torque characteristics of the matching engine should comply with the provisions of the relevant diesel engine standards.
4.14 The tractor should be able to start smoothly when the minimum ambient temperature is less than or equal to 5℃. 4.15 The exhaust smoke density of the TY41 engine under the rated working condition should not exceed 4.0 Bo Xu units. For TY51 and TY61 models, the exhaust smoke density from the rated speed to the maximum torque speed should not exceed 4.5 Bo Xu units at full load speed characteristics. The engine speed shall not have obvious high and low phenomena; there shall be no abnormal noise; and the phenomenon of oil inspection is not allowed. 4.16
4.17 The transmission box of the tractor shall be clean, and the factory cleanliness limit is that the impurity content of each unit shall not exceed 162mg. 4.18 The V-belt groove of the engine pulley and the V-belt groove of the clutch pulley shall be aligned, and the tension adjustment shall comply with the provisions of the tractor instruction manual, and the engine's full torque can be transmitted. ) The clutch shall be able to separate completely, engage smoothly, and be able to transmit all torque when engaged. 4.19
When the tractor is working in various gears, the gearbox shall not have the phenomenon of disordered gears and gear disengagement, and the transmission system shall not have abnormal noise. 4.21
1 The steering mechanism and operating mechanism on the left and right sides shall be adjusted in unison. When the steering mechanism on one side is separated, the tractor shall be able to steer flexibly and reliably.
4.22 When the ambient temperature is not lower than 35℃ and the tractor is working continuously for 4 hours at close to full load, the oil temperature of the transmission system shall not be higher than 80℃. 4.23
3 On a dry and hard slope at 20℃, the tractor brakes should ensure that the single machine can stop reliably in the uphill direction. 2
JB/T5180-1991
4.24 The dynamic environmental noise of the tractor should not be greater than 84dB (A), and the noise near the driver's ear should not be greater than 91dB (A). 4.25
The mean time between failures (MTBF value) of the tractor should not be less than 250h. 4.26 The exposed rotating parts such as the pulley and power output shaft of the tractor should be equipped with protective covers. 4.27 Necessary safety warning signs should be set up in conspicuous parts of the tractor. The markings and symbols should be accurate and eye-catching. 4.28 If the user unit uses and maintains the tractor in accordance with the instruction manual provided by the manufacturer, within 12 months from the date of delivery, but not more than 1500 working hours, if the tractor is damaged or cannot be used normally due to the manufacturer's responsibility, the manufacturer shall be responsible for repairing or replacing the damaged parts free of charge.
5 Test methods
5.1 The engine bench test shall be carried out in accordance with the provisions of GB1105.2. 5.2 The whole machine parameter measurement, operation test, ramp parking brake test, noise measurement, traction test, hand crank start test and long-term use test of the tractor shall be carried out in accordance with the provisions of GB6229. 5.3 The cleanliness measurement of the tractor shall be carried out in accordance with the provisions of GB6231. 5.4 The reliability use test, reliability assessment method and reliability fault judgment rule of the tractor shall comply with the provisions of relevant standards. 6 Inspection rules
6.1 Factory inspection
6.1.1 For each assembled tractor, the engine must be started for factory inspection to check the manufacturing and assembly quality of the tractor, adjust the various working mechanisms, and preliminarily run-in the moving parts. The following items shall be inspected before leaving the factory: a. The correctness and reliability of the clutch, brake, steering mechanism, etc.; b. Whether the tension of the triangle belt is appropriate; c. Is there any abnormal noise in the gearbox? d. Is there any overheating in the moving and friction parts such as bearings? e. Is there any oil leakage, water leakage or air leakage? f. Are the connections of various parts and components firm? g. Check the working stability of the engine at various speeds and whether the oil supply system and cooling system work normally. 6.1.2 Factory inspection specifications a. Test in the order of speed levels 1, 2, 3, 4, 5, 6, reverse 1, reverse 2, and run each level at no load for 1~2 minutes; b. Each speed level should be tested for clutch, gear shifting, steering and braking; c. If a tractor is found to have a fault during the test, additional tests should be carried out after the fault is eliminated. 6.2 Type inspection Type inspection shall be carried out in accordance with the provisions of relevant standards. 6.3 Regular sampling inspection For tractors produced in batches, the manufacturer shall regularly select samples from the products recently produced for whole machine performance tests and reliability use tests.
7 Delivery
7.1 Each tractor must be inspected and approved by the manufacturer's technical inspection department, and issued with a certificate of conformity before it can leave the factory. 7.2 The following work must be done before the delivery of the tractor:3
JB/T5180—1991
a. Carry out an appearance inspection of the tractor to ensure that the tractor is in good condition and all external fasteners are firm; b. Drain the cooling water and diesel;
c. Check and adjust the tire pressure to the factory specified value, and the tire must not be filled with liquid. 7.3 In addition to the accessories provided according to the order requirements, each tractor shipped must be equipped with spare parts, accessories and random tools in accordance with the product manual:
7.4 For each tractor shipped, the manufacturer shall provide the following documents:a. Tractor manual;
b. Tractor parts catalog;
c. Tractor certificate;
d. List of spare parts, accessories and random tools; e. Packing list.
7.5 For the delivered tractor, the representative of the ordering party has the right to inspect all parts of the tractor in the manufacturer and may start the tractor if necessary but shall not disassemble the tractor.
8 Marking, packaging, transportation and storage
8.1 The main parts and wearing parts of the tractor shall have factory markings. 8.2 The tractor shall have a nameplate, which shall include at least the following information: a. Manufacturer name; b. Tractor model; c. Factory serial number and year and month.
8.3 The shipped tractor, including spare parts, accessories and random tools, shall be guaranteed not to be damaged or lost during normal transportation. 8.4 When the ordering party requires the tractor to be packed, it shall comply with the relevant provisions of the packaging standards so that the tractor is firmly fixed in the box. The outside of the packaging box shall be marked with: a. Manufacturer name, factory mark and address; b. Product name and model; c. Factory serial number and year and month;
d, overall dimensions lxb×h, mm;
e. Total weight, kg;
f. Shipping address and name of the consignee;
g. Markings such as "Do not invert", "Upward", "Handle with care", "Moisture-proof" and the position of the lashing rope. 8.5 Under normal transportation and storage conditions, the manufacturer shall ensure that the rust-proof validity period of the tractor and its spare parts, accessories and random tools is not less than 12 months from the date of leaving the factory.
